NORWAY’S KING REVIEWS SANDHURST PARADE.—King Olav V, who took the salute at the Sovereign’s Parade at the Royal Military Academy, Sandhurst, inspecting some of the officer cadets. He is talking to Prince Hamad (second from right), son of Sheikh Khalifa bin Hamad el-Thani, Prime Minister of Qatar. His Majesty is wearing the uniform of an honorary admiral of the British Royal Navy.
